Overview of Lovable and Bolt.new
What They Do
- Lovable: An AI tool designed to automate coding tasks, manage project workflows, and provide real-time suggestions based on your coding style.
- Bolt.new: A coding assistant that focuses on generating code snippets and providing instant debugging support, making it easier for developers to tackle complex problems.

Feature Comparison
User Interface
Both tools have a clean interface, but Lovable offers a more integrated experience with project management features. Bolt.new’s interface is straightforward, making it easy to jump right into coding.
Code Generation
- Lovable: Generates code based on your previous work patterns but requires some initial setup to tailor suggestions effectively.
- Bolt.new: Instant code snippets based on prompts. It’s faster but sometimes lacks contextual understanding, leading to less relevant outputs.
Debugging Support
- Lovable: Offers basic debugging suggestions, but they can be hit-or-miss.
- Bolt.new: Provides real-time debugging insights that are generally more reliable for quick fixes.
Collaboration Features
- Lovable: Strong collaboration tools, allowing teams to manage tasks and share progress seamlessly.
- Bolt.new: Lacks collaboration features, focusing purely on individual productivity.

Which Tool to Choose?
Choose Lovable if:
- You need robust project management features alongside coding assistance.
- Your team collaborates frequently and you want a tool that supports that dynamic.
Choose Bolt.new if:
- You’re looking for a straightforward, no-frills coding assistant.
- You need quick code generation and debugging without the added complexity of project management.
Conclusion: Start Here
After testing both tools in various scenarios, here’s my recommendation: if you’re working solo or on small projects, Bolt.new is the way to go for its speed and simplicity. However, if you’re part of a team that requires comprehensive project management alongside coding capabilities, Lovable will serve you better.
